SKF 10X26X7 HMSA10 RG Seal, 10mm Inside Diameter, 26mm Outside Diameter - 10X26X7 HMSA10 RG
This seal is a rotary shaft seal designed for reliable performance in various applications. Constructed from nitrile rubber, it is engineered to function effectively between rotating and stationary components. Measuring 10mm in shaft diameter and 26mm in housing bore, this seal offers robust sealing solutions, ensuring compatibility in many mechanical environments.
Features & Benefits
• Designed with a rubber-metal reinforced outside diameter ensures durability and long-lasting performance
• Garter spring provides enhanced sealing performance for reliable operation
• Non-contacting auxiliary lip optimises sealing against contaminants for improved protection
• High contamination exclusion ensures longevity in polluted conditions for consistent performance
Applications
• Used with machinery requiring effective oil or grease sealing
• Ideal for where dust and contaminants are present
• Suitable for industrial settings with rotating machinery
• Utilised in the automotive and mechanical engineering sectors
What is the significance of the auxiliary lip design?
The auxiliary lip enhances sealing effectiveness by preventing fluid leakage, which is particularly important in environments with debris or contamination that could affect the primary seal's performance.
How does this seal accommodate misalignment?
The seal's design incorporates flexibility, allowing it to function properly even when aligned conditions are not perfect, which helps prolong service life and reduce wear.
What are the maximum operational speeds for effective use?
This seal can handle rotational speeds of up to 2,520 r/min, enabling it to be used in high-speed applications without compromising seal integrity.
What performance can be expected in extreme temperatures?
With a minimum operating temperature of -40°C and a maximum of +100°C, it maintains efficient sealing capabilities under challenging thermal conditions.
